Belarus will welcome Spain to the Borisov Arena on Sunday, the 14th of June in a Euro Qualification encounter. Check the live TV and online streaming broadcast listings for Belarus vs Spain below.

Del Bosque's men are surprisingly not top of the table in Group C, with the position currently occupied by Slovakia who beat Spain 2-1 when the two sides met in September last year. The reigning European champions will be adamant to avoid a further blip for it may allow the group leaders to further extend their lead who face an easy fixture against  Macedonia.

Barcelona defender Gerard Pique was jeered by his own fans after making controversial remarks but has insisted that he will not let that effect his performance.

"The thing is that I have just come from winning the treble," Pique explained.

"I'm very, very happy. Smile from ear to ear. And that is the perfect reply to the shouts - a smile."

"Don't think that the shouts affect me. It is part of my job. I don't think it's unjust. The people are welcome to protest, it's their right to do it."

Meanwhile Spain head coach Vicente Del Bosque has called for unity ahead of the important match against Belarus and has appealed for the supporters to stand behind all the players.

"I don’t think what happened is right," Del Bosque said. "Whistling one player is the same as whistling the whole team.

"It leaves me with a very bad taste. The most important thing is that we are united."

Pique's club teammate Marc Bartra also condemned the reactions of a certain section of fans towards the former Man United man and has insisted that he deserves a better treatment.

"He doesn't deserve that," Bartra told reporters.

"In footballing terms he has always gone to the ends of the earth for Barcelona and the national side. It makes me sad because he's a good guy.

"Maybe he lost his head a bit but in the end people have to remember everything he has given."

Spain have not been on their best runs in recent games having suffered two defeats in their last five matches which includes losses at the hands of Netherlands and Germany. It is important that the 2010 World Champions produce a better performance this time around especially because third placed Ukraine trail them by just three points.

Spain emerged successful when the two sides met in the reverse fixture back in November. Isco opened up the scoring for the home side in the match followed by goals from Busquets and Pedro to hand Spain a comfortable 3-0 win.

Belarus on the other hand have managed just four points from the five matches they have played but manager Aleksandr Khatskevich is confident that his team can get a positive result.

"I will accept any result as long as there are no half-hearted players in the team.

"Of course Spain are better than us in every aspect but we can fight them with our team game and try to exploit their weaknesses. And they have those weaknesses, trust me."


 

 

Match details, result and original broadcast info

Belarus 0 - 1 Spain

June 14, 2015 2:45pmBorisov Arena (Barysaw (Borisov))
